CREATIVE EDGE: Community Roundtable Meetings Announced!

You are invited to join the conversation about the future of the arts in our city and region as part of Creative Edge: Sacramento’s Arts, Culture, and Creative Economy Plan. Our consulting team, Cultural Planning Group, will gather input from the arts community, patrons, and advocates in a series of topical Roundtable discussions.

Your input around community challenges, opportunities, and priorities will help our team to better understand how the arts may be better integrated into the priorities of local government and the community overall, creating a more dynamic artists ecosystem, and greater access for all.

Creative Edge is an initiative to gather priorities, expectations, and needs regarding the Arts, Culture, and Creative Economy in the Sacramento area. The plan will engage the community at large to create a comprehensive vision of culture and creativity for our city. The goal is to strengthen cultural vitality through excellent, relevant, and sustainable results that can be implemented over the next five to seven years.
